Output 0664abf6d66a597c8fbb729b3882a605550bcf0ada8ffb86bcf3dd0773b139f9:0

value
3131500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b53c4a2d7aeb78e95eaf82a699a8141a91261f OP_EQUAL
address
3PBKq63D3tMfHu6hJPZSsvdk75tqMCaxmi
transaction
0664abf6d66a597c8fbb729b3882a605550bcf0ada8ffb86bcf3dd0773b139f9
spent
true